An extremely well preserved Kriegsmarine Coastal Artillery Officers overseas cap, constructed of field grey wool. The cap is fully surrounded by fold down side walls which gently slope toward the front. The edge of the walls is fully trimmed by a length of fine gold bullion wire piping.
